WebApr 11, 2024 · Moles tunnel in your yard because there’s food there. “This activity is generally a continuation of tunneling from an adjacent area,” Dickens says. If you have well-drained, loose soil with lots of insect activity and earthworms, a mole will find it appealing. Unlike getting rid of squirrels, moles are easily discouraged. WebFeb 20, 2024 · Surround your lawn and garden by a trench, 6 inches wide by 2 feet deep. Then, fill this with rocks or install a lining that is made of hardware cloth with holes or wire mesh. The sturdy materials will keep the moles from extending their tunnel system into your yard but this measure is very time-consuming. 6.

Moles, voles, and groundhogs are often confused with one another, because they all burrow beneath the ground. However, while moles tend to make large holes like groundhogs do because they excavate soil, they often don't leave the lawn.
